angelina jolie was reduced to tears while talking about her late mother marcheline bertrand yesterday.the 33-year-old beauty - whose french-canadian mom died in january 2008 - couldn't contain her emotions when she was asked about the late actress at a press conference for her new film 'changeling' in london.
angelina said: "she was really sweet and was never angry - she couldn't swear to save her life.but when it came to her kids, she was really fierce and so this is very much her, her story. "she was the woman i related to, who had that elegance and strength through just knowing what was right."
angelina - who confirmed she will replace tom cruise in new spy thriller 'edwin a. salt' - also denied claims she is retiring.the actress, who raises six children with partner brad pitt, added: "i'm not making some retirement announcement.i have a big family and a lot of responsibility at home, and i have the good fortune to financially not have to work all the time.
"i just feel privileged that i get to be home a lot. but maybe eventually i'll stop acting."
